Subject: Sweeper cut-over complete

The Tidewrack orphaned-resource sweeper is now live on the new cluster as of this morning. Old instance is stopped but not deleted; we'll remove it Friday. Sweep cadence and deletion grace periods are unchanged. If alerts fire tonight, check the dry-run flag first. The active configuration is reproduced below for reference.

settings of yageg-yahap:
[gorael]
team = olieth
access_code = ac_941d74
owner = brieth.aldiel
host = gorael.tolvaqio.internal
port = 6379
peer = briwyn.urlaqtech.internal
salt = 116e6622
pin = 1957

Handover note — Crumbwheel order cutoffs.

Welcome aboard. The bakery cutoff rule in Crumbwheel closes same-day orders at 14:00 local to each storefront, not UTC — this has bitten us twice. Holiday overrides live in the calendar service and take precedence silently, so always check there first when a cutoff looks wrong. To unlock the calendar service's admin console after a restart, enter the recovery passphrase below.

vault phrase of bagap-bahaf = silion-pelox-sorox-casdor-quenwyn-fraax-eliox-praael-kelion-quenvan-kasox-rusael-norius-belvan

Subject: Handover — validator plugin stuff

Hey Priya,

Passing you the baton on Checkwright, our plugin system for data validators. The new schema-drift plugin shipped Tuesday and mostly behaves, but it occasionally flags empty CSV uploads as "malformed" — harmless, just noisy. I've muted the alert until Friday. If support escalates anything about plugin load failures, the fix is usually bumping the registry cache. Questions after I'm off? Reach the Checkwright maintainers at the address below.

billing contact of hawip-kahif = zorwyn@tolvaqlabs.corp